Dr Alan Murtagh - A Private Psychiatrist in Dublin

Dr Alan Murtagh specialises in general adult psychiatry and adult ADHD. He also treats other mental health issues, such as bipolar disorder and private psychiatrist anxiety. He treats patients from all across Ireland. He offers his services with cost-effective and reasonable prices.

His clinical practice combines a supportive psychoanalytically-orientated approach to eliciting the roots of distress with progressive person-centred psychiatry aimed at alleviating suffering through pragmatic use of medication. His clients include individuals and families.

Dr Aideen is a consultant in general adult psychiatry in the Department of Adult Psychiatry of Connolly Hospital Blanchardstown. She completed her senior registrar training through the Irish National Higher Training Scheme for Psychiatry. She also completed a year of special interest in psychotherapy for forensic purposes. She is interested in the use of cognitive behavior therapy (CBT) for the treatment of common mental disorders, such as depression, anxiety, panic and obsessive compulsive disorder.

She has a special interest in ADHD and is the Advanced Nurse Practitioner for the specialist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der service - ADMiRE at the Dublin North City Mental Health Services. She recently published an article on the use of electronic prescriptions within this service. She is also an academic at the Tivoli Institute, where she supervises the PG Diploma CBT.

In most cases, it is not necessary for a person to see a psychiatrist if they have mental health issues. In the majority of cases, a general practitioner can help and refer a patient to other members of the mental health team like a clinical psychologist, occupational therapist or psychotherapist. Some of the most popular charities in Dublin include Aware, Pieta House, and Anxiety Ireland. These organizations offer assistance to people with a wide range of problems, including suicidal ideas and relationship issues. Some organizations provide more specific help such as OCD or trichotillomania. Anxiety Ireland, for instance offers a 14-week cognitive behavioral program to those suffering from anxiety.

Dr Devlin is a consultant psychiatrist for children and adolescents with a focus on authentic comprehensive clinical assessments and youth mindfulness. She also offers educational talks for teachers in schools primary care, social and mental health workers in adolescent psychiatry and in mindfulness.

She has worked in the NHS as a trainee in different services including liaison, perinatal and general adult psychiatry. She has a special interest in eating disorders and has written articles on the topic. She also contributed to the publication of model care guidelines for this field.

In addition to her work with children and adolescents, she has also been involved in suicide prevention efforts and has a keen interest in the psychosis of adolescents. She has spoken at international conferences and published on the topic.

Highfield Healthcare in Blanchardstown offers many different services, including a day-hospital for those who participate in therapy programmes (Monday through Friday) and an outpatient clinic that allows one-on-one appointments with psychiatrists and therapists. There is also an inpatient facility and a home for elderly patients with a severe mental illness. The staff is dedicated to improving the care of patients. They provide support to families and patients and try to meet the needs of each patient. They also educate the general public about mental disease. They also offer free screenings for Alzheimer's, depression and dementia.
